About Antoine Nasrallah
Antoine Nasrallah is a scholar working on Cardiology and Cardiovascular Medicine, Internal Medicine and Complementary and alternative medicine, having authored 23 papers that have together received 294 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Cardiac Arrhythmias and Treatments (5 papers), Acute Myocardial Infarction Research (5 papers) and Cardiac pacing and defibrillation studies (4 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Cardiology and Cardiovascular Medicine (167 citations), Pulmonary and Respiratory Medicine (114 citations) and Epidemiology (94 citations). Antoine Nasrallah has collaborated with scholars based in United States, Lebanon and Denmark. Frequent co-authors include Robert J. Hall, Grady L. Hallman, Denton A. Cooley, Efrain Garcia, P C Gillette, Charles E. Mullins, Samir Alam, Dan G. McNamara, Gunyon M. Harrison and Don B. Singer. Their work appears in journals such as Circulation, CHEST Journal and The American Journal of Cardiology.
